Ruby Helgeson, 90

Published 8:31 am Wednesday, September 6, 2017

Ruby Helgeson, 90, died on Sept. 3, 2017, at her home in Austin, Minnesota.

Ruby was born on March 27, 1927,  in Austin. She was the second child of Alfred and Emma (Mensink) Severson. She graduated from Austin High School where she was active in girls sports. After high school, she moved to Mason City, Iowa, where she met and married LuVerne Helgeson on July 4, 1947. They lived in Kensett, Iowa, where Ruby spent her working years in various manufacturing facilities. While in Kensett, she contributed many hours of volunteer service for the  VFW Auxiliary and for the community.

Upon retirement and LuVerne’s passing, she moved to Apache Junction, Arizona, for 10 years. While in Arizona she traveled with friends to destinations such as Alaska, Hawaii and Norway. At this time she also took up lifetime exercise of swimming and learned woodcarving, which was on her bucket list. She moved back to Northwood to be near family and friends.
